First-Day Checklist — Item 3: Holiday-Period Opening Hours

Brief every new starter on the reduced hours in force at Copperfield Exchange during the Midwinter closure. The main atrium opens 08:30–17:00 rather than the usual 07:00–21:00, and the Penrose Wing is shut entirely until the 4th. Reception staff should confirm the starter knows that out-of-hours entry requires sign-in at the night desk, plus a valid badge. If their permanent badge has not arrived, issue the holiday-period door code printed below.

turnstile pass: bdg-EVG-1

### Step 4: Swap the ORM adapter

Plugins targeting the old Grindlewood ORM must now register through the Ferrous adapter shim. Remove direct model imports; query builders are injected instead. Run the compatibility linter before publishing. Your plugin manifest must declare the shim version, and your environment needs the adapter settings shown below.

deployment values, tagug-tagaf:
[zorix]
team = druix
access_code = ac_42e3e2
host = zorix.qirvancorp.test
port = 6379
owner = beldor.gordor
peer = kelath.zemvarcorp.test

## Runbook: Cron drift on the Marrowgate scheduler

If nightly jobs on Marrowgate start a few minutes late and the gap grows each day, you are likely seeing cron drift. It usually traces back to the host clock sync service losing its upstream, not to the scheduler itself. First confirm the drift with the timing report, then check sync status before touching any job definitions. The scheduler's current timing configuration, for reference during the investigation, is:

deployment values, yafop-tahof:
HOLIX_HOST=holix.zemvarsys.internal
HOLIX_PORT=3306

## Cron Migration — Support Notes

We're moving legacy cron jobs from Tickwell boxes into the Loomis workflow engine. During migration, some scheduled reports may run twice; tell customers this is expected through Friday. If a customer's workflow stalls, you can unlock the Loomis recovery console by entering the passphrase that appears below.

vault phrase of tajop-haduf = holath-brivan-wenax